Nucleoplasty for cervical radiculopathy or cervical radicular pain due to disc herniation

Abstract

This is the protocol for a review and there is no abstract. The objectives are as follows: To determine whether nucleoplasty improves clinical and functional outcomes compared to surgery or conservative treatment for patients with cervical radicular pain, radiculopathy due to disc herniation or both.
